POSITION PURPOSE Inspect assigned areas in order to provide feedback to management and employees on the cleanliness and maintenance of those areas against standards.

Job Description

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S Supervise the performance of room attendants and general cleaning and take appropriate action to correct deficient conditions, behavior, and work practices. Inspect guest rooms, guest areas and employee areas and assess compliance with all established standards as they relate to cleanliness, maintenance, safety, and security. Report, as directed, any observed deviations to established standards. Produce schedules for employees in accordance with staffing guides/productivity requirements. Review and adjust staffing daily to ensure optimum staffing levels. Review assignments of employees and make adjustments. Communicate throughout the day with Front Office and other departments to ensure total guest satisfaction. Monitor consumption and order replacement of guest and cleaning supplies. Manage administrative functions in accordance with established standards.
